INGREDIENTS
- 4 ACE Bakery® Classic Sausage Gourmet Buns, warmed
- 1 lb cooked lobster, cut into chunks
- 2/3 cup chopped celery
- 1/4 cup mayonnaise
- 2 tbsp. plain Greek yogurt
- 2 tbsp. chopped fresh chives
- 1 tbsp. Dijon mustard
- 1 tbsp. lemon juice
- 1/4 tsp. each salt and pepper
- 2 tbsp. butter, softened
- 8 leaves Boston lettuce

INSTRUCTIONS
- In large bowl, combine lobster, celery, mayonnaise, yogurt, chives, mustard, lemon juice, salt and pepper.
- Using sharp knife, slice down along top of each bun lengthwise. Gently pull open; spread buns inside with butter.
- Line buns with lettuce. Scoop lobster mixture evenly into buns.
